CSS是網頁設計的一個重要組成部分,它可以幫助我們控制網頁的外觀和行為。其中,頁面縮放是非常常見的操作,用戶會通過瀏覽器的縮放功能來調整網頁的大小。但是,如果我們沒有考慮好頁面縮放對網頁的影響,就會出現各種問題。
那么,如何通過CSS來設計頁面縮放呢?以下是一些實用的技巧:
/* 限制最小寬度 */ body { min-width: 960px; } /* 自適應寬度 */ .container { width: 100%; max-width: 1200px; margin: 0 auto; } /* 字號和行高 */ body { font-size: 16px; line-height: 1.6; } /* 響應式圖片 */ img { max-width: 100%; height: auto; }
首先,我們需要限制最小寬度,避免頁面縮放后出現橫向滾動條。可以在body上設置min-width屬性,以確保網頁的最小寬度。
接著,我們可以使用自適應布局,即使用百分比寬度或max-width屬性來保持網頁在不同屏幕上的合適顯示。例如,在容器元素上設置width: 100%; max-width: 1200px,這樣容器會自適應屏幕寬度但不會超過1200px。
同時,我們還需要考慮縮放對字號和行高的影響。一般來說,網頁字號應該設置為相對大小(如em或rem),這樣可以根據父元素的字號自動調整大小。在此基礎上,我們可以設置body的字號和行高,以確??s放后文本的可讀性。
最后,還需要特別關注圖片的縮放。我們可以使用css的max-width和height:auto屬性對圖片進行響應式調整,確保在縮放時保持適當的比例。
綜上所述,通過以上幾個技巧,我們能夠更好地控制網頁的縮放效果,提升用戶體驗。